Episode#10: Fourier-transform Infrared Spectroscopy – Cameron Jordan

Hello listeners,

This week we discuss a routine but handy technique called FTIR. Cameron Jordan, a Graduate student will discuss how FTIR can help us determine various structural features in a molecule. Thank you for joining us, and I hope you keep listening.
